Solution for 2(1l+5)=54 equation:


Simplifying
2(1l + 5) = 54

Reorder the terms:
2(5 + 1l) = 54
(5 * 2 + 1l * 2) = 54
(10 + 2l) = 54

Solving
10 + 2l = 54

Solving for variable 'l'.

Move all terms containing l to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-10' to each side of the equation.
10 + -10 + 2l = 54 + -10

Combine like terms: 10 + -10 = 0
0 + 2l = 54 + -10
2l = 54 + -10

Combine like terms: 54 + -10 = 44
2l = 44

Divide each side by '2'.
l = 22

Simplifying
l = 22
